What Is Safeguarding?

Safeguarding means taking proactive steps to protect people — especially children and young workers — from harm, abuse, and exploitation. In the context of au pair placements, safeguarding covers the wellbeing of both the children in a family's care and the au pair themselves.

South African law gives au pairs specific rights and protections. The Basic Conditions of Employment Act (BCEA) and the Children's Act 38 of 2005 set out clear standards for working conditions, child protection, and the responsibilities of both employers (families) and workers (au pairs). AuPairly is designed to support — not replace — these legal protections.

Our Commitment to Safety

We take our responsibility seriously. Here is what AuPairly does to keep everyone on the platform safe:

Profile Review

Every au pair profile is manually reviewed by our team before it becomes visible to families. We check for completeness, appropriateness, and consistency.

Verification Badges

Au pairs can earn verification badges for ID verification, reference checks, first aid certification, and qualification checks. These badges appear on their profile so families can make informed decisions.

Report & Block

Any user can report or block another user at any time. Our admin team reviews all reports and takes action — including profile suspension — where warranted.

In-Platform Messaging

Initial contact stays within AuPairly's messaging system, giving both parties a record of all communications before they choose to exchange personal contact details.
